Vanier Scholarship for International students is sponsored by the Canadian government in its aim to establish Canada as a hub for education and research. The Vanier scholarship is a postgraduate scholarship that is meant to attract the best doctoral students to Canada , the scholarship offers student financial support in their pursuit of a PhD or MD/PhD in Canada.
This program is fully backed by the Canadian government as it drive to make Canada a centre for research and higher learning to increase the country’s competitiveness.
Host institutions
The Canadian government has partner Canadian institutions where the Vanier Canada graduate school scholarship is done. And the particular institution that nominated a candidate is where the candidate’s scholarship is tenable.

The number of Vanier Scholarships
There are up to 166 positions available.
Target Group
The people who are eligible are Canadian citizens , permanent residents of Canada and foreign citizens.
Value of the Scholarship
The Vanier scholarship is $50,000 for the 3 years it is to last.
Eligibility for Vanier Scholarships
The prestigious awards are designed to give Canada a lead and be to a go-to place for the best research minds. To select the best from large pool, the scholarship has some criteria that must be met before one is considered . To stand a chance , you must ;
- Be nominated by a Canadian institution of higher learning which must have received a Vanier quota.
- The candidate must be pursuing his or her first doctorate degrees including a joint program such as MD/PhD in an area with a significant research component . The program will only fund the PhD part of a joint program.
- The students intend to study for a full time doctorate in the summer semester or the next academic year following the announcement of the results at the nominating institution .
4. Applicants must not have completed more than 20 MONTHS OF doctoral studies as of May 2021.
5. Must have not completed more than 32 months of full time studies in their doctoral program by May 2021if they were accelerated from a bachelor’s program into a PhD program.
6. Must have received a first class average in the last two years of full time studies of its equivalent .
6. Candidates must not hold or have held a doctoral level scholarship or fellowship from CIHR, NSERC or SSRRC to undertake or complete a doctoral degree.
How to apply for Vanier Scholarships
The first to remember is that each candidate must be nominated by a Canadian institution that has a veneer quota. As no candidate is fret apply directly to the vanier CGS program.
Applications can actually be done in one of two ways. The student can inform the faculty of graduate studies at the institute they want to undertake the program about their intention to apply to Lanier CGS or the institution can initiate the process by contacting the candidate.
The application is prepared by the students and submitted to the institution to use for the nomination using the ResesearchgateNet application system. The recommending institutions then forward the application to the Vanier-Banting secretariat by 3 November 2020.
